Kazakhstan

In Atyrau, the holistic Zangar initiative filled critical gaps for youth in life skills and science, technology, and math (STEM) education. With training relevant to the local job market, participants were prepared to succeed. Mindful of long-term programmatic sustainability, we also led a coalition of local community-based organizations and helped build their capacity to serve vulnerable youth. By empowering young people with the skills to be personally and professional involved in their communities, we also worked to restore important social engagement. From the start, the Zangar initiative was driven by youth and the local community–for example, they voted on the name, which means “mighty” in Kazakh.
